RBC I The Bureau of Land Management will host public meetings in Silt and Craig next week to discuss the Northwest Colorado Sage Grouse environmental impact statement (EIS) and to seek public comment on the plan.
Public meetings will be held from 4 p.m. to 7 p.m. at the following locations:
On Monday in Silt, the meeting will be held at the BLM Colorado River Valley Field Office, 2300 River Frontage Rd. On Tuesday in Craig, the meeting will be held at Memorial Hospital at Craig, 750 Hospital Loop.
The draft considers four possible management alternatives for maintaining and increasing habitat for Greater Sage-Grouse on BLM and Routt National Forest lands in northwestern Colorado. The alternatives apply to federal lands and minerals only, not to private lands.
